hello, I have a tender and itchy vagina. i am trying to find a safe way to remedy it. are vaginal creams safe? without knowledge of what the cause is? this is unusual for me, I have never had a yeast infection before, and I have tried to reach my gynecologist. it is a holiday and a weekend I may not get help for a week. should I wait a week? ive read so many causes and reasons for the itch. can I use a anti itch cream until I get to my physician? are they safe? will it make things worse? any help will be appreciated.
Hello dear I understand your concern Your symptoms could be due to the vaginal infection (bacterial vaginosis, yeast), contact dermatitis. Vaginal examination by the gynaecologist is must to diagnose the cause. Vaginal swab test and microscopy will help to find the cause.
